|
|
|
lackware 11/bash скрипт: проблема с именами, включающими про
|
|||
|---|---|---|---|
|
#18+
Здравствуйте! Имеется баш скрипт для генерации черновых *.dcf контент файлов для Qt Assistant 4. (Сканнирует текущий каталог на предмет html, выкусывает из них sed'ом заголовки и печатает это все в stdout: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. пробелы, так как for..in разбивает тест именно по пробелам. Т.е. если в каталоги будет документ "./big document.html", то сначала оно пытается открыть "./big" а потом "document.html". Как это можно исправить для данного скрипта? (например, как каждую строчку из find заключить в кавычки?) Насколько я понял, из флагов find только -ls обрабатывает пробелы и прочие сиvволы перед которыми надо ставить \ . Проблема в том, что с -ls текст выводиться в 9 колонок, и последнюю колонку awk'ом выкусить не удается, так как там пробелы :). Как это решить? Спасибо. Posted via ActualForum NNTP Server 1.4 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 22.06.2007, 23:37:53 |
|
||
|
lackware 11/bash скрипт: проблема с именами, включающими про
|
|||
|---|---|---|---|
|
#18+
ErV see field separator in the bash advanced scripting guide... PS no offence, just a little of promille 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.06.2007, 03:35:57 |
|
||
|
lackware 11/bash скрипт: проблема с именами, включающими про
|
|||
|---|---|---|---|
|
#18+
Ося wrote: > see field separator in the bash advanced scripting guide... Ок, спасибо. > PS no offence, just a little of promille Никаких проблем, ведь указатель направления есть :) Это ведь часть идеологии системы, как никак :) Вопрос закрыт. Posted via ActualForum NNTP Server 1.4 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 23.06.2007, 05:18:34 |
|
||
|
|

start [/forum/topic.php?fid=25&msg=34615075&tid=1488041]: |
0ms |
get settings: |
10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
59ms |
get topic data: |
10ms |
get forum data: |
3ms |
get page messages: |
38ms |
get tp. blocked users: |
1ms |
| others: | 234ms |
| total: | 376ms |

| 0 / 0 |
